POSITION TITLE: Custodian

RATE OF PAY: $15.50 - $22.75 depending on experience

REPORTS TO:
Principal/Director of Building & Grounds

DEPARTMENT: Buildings & Grounds

BENEFITS: Full Benefit package, including accrued leave days, vacation time and retirement

SHIFT: Evenings

This is a 12-month position/40 hours per week. Compensation will be adjusted in consideration of prior custodial experience.

Primary Duty

To provide students with a safe, attractive, comfortable, clean and efficient place in which to learn, play and develop by keeping school buildings in sanitary, working condition.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S include the following. Other duties may be assigned.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

  • Sweeps, mops, scrubs, and vacuums hallways and corridors. Dusts and cleans furniture.
  • Follows procedures for the use of chemical cleaners and power equipment to prevent damage to floors and fixtures.
  • Disinfects restrooms, sanitary fixtures, and drinking fountains daily.
  • Mixes water and detergents or acids in containers to prepare cleaning solutions, according to specifications.
  • Cleans windows, glass partitions, and mirrors, and chalkboards.
  • Maintains building(s), performing minor and routine painting, plumbing, electrical wiring, and other related maintenance activities as approved by the Principal/Director of Building Grounds.
  • Notifies management concerning need for major repairs or additions to lighting, heating, and ventilating equipment
  • Assumes responsibility for the opening and closing of the building and for determining, before leaving, that all doors and windows are secured, and all lights, except those left on for safety reasons, are turned off.
  • Checks daily to ensure that all exit doors are open and all panic bolts are working properly during the hours of building occupancy.
  • Moves furniture or equipment within buildings as required for various activities and directed by the principal/supervisor.
  • Reports and properly documents any damage or misuse of school property to the Director of Building and Grounds and the Principal.
  • Posts signs to caution students or faculty of wet floors or services temporarily out of order.
  • Complies with procedures for the storage and disposal of trash, rubbish and waste.
